Bath Disability Trust
Full Description of Organisation
Improving the quality of life for physically or mentally impaired people in Bath
Bath Disability Trust was formerly known as Bath Association for Disabled People (BADP), formed to promote and co-ordinate activities and organisations assisting disabled people and their families. In 1993 a significant sum of money was bequeathed to the Association to be held in trust for the benefit of people in Bath and its immediately adjoining parishes. It is the management of the charitable fund which is the Trust’s primary function today.
The Trustees meet six times a year to consider applications for funding to improve the quality of life for physically or mentally impaired people in Bath.
